Chalet de la Combe Gelée sits at 1,850m in the Chaîne des Aravis, above the village of Manigod in Haute-Savoie. The standard approach takes 2 hours from the Nant Brun carpark (1,430m), following a well-marked trail through alpine meadows and larch forest. The route climbs steadily but without technical sections. In winter, ski touring access is straightforward from the same starting point. The hut occupies a pastoral setting with views north toward Mont-Blanc's massif.
The chalet operates year-round and accommodates 40 people in mixed dormitory rooms. Meals are prepared daily and the kitchen serves hearty mountain fare. There's a simple bar area and wood-burning stove for the common room. Showers and toilets are basic but functional. Mobile signal is unreliable; bring cash as the hut may not process card payments reliably. Winter access requires checking conditions ahead with the guardian.
Book directly with the hut by phone or email. July and August fill quickly; reserve 3-4 weeks ahead for peak season. Weekends year-round attract day-hikers and require booking several weeks in advance. The hut is popular with families and groups doing the multi-day Aravis trek. Email or call ahead if you have dietary requirements or plan to arrive outside standard meal times.
